Cookin’ for Kids Oyster Roast

Augusta Aviation (Daniel Field Airport) on Highland Avenue will host the 14th annual Cookin’ for Kids Oyster Roast on March 9 at 6:00 PM. Enjoy all-you-can-eat oysters, sides, desserts, and unlimited beer and wine. Tickets are $50 and proceeds benefit local victims of child abuse, neglect and exploitation through Child Enrichment Inc. There is also a live auction and musical entertainment.

Children’s Hike with Story Time

On March 10 from 9:30-11:30 AM, children from toddlers to age 8 and their parents can enjoy a nature hike designed specifically for kids at Phinizy Swamp Nature Park. Admission is $2 and accompanying adults are free. Children will enjoy a story before and after their hike and experience nature first-hand.

5th Annual Trillium Trek

The Central Savannah River Land Trust will hold their 5th annual Trillium Trek on Saturday, March 23 beginning at 10:00 AM. It is a guided hike on Greystone Preserve in North Augusta in search of the endangered Relict Trillium plant.
